    Easy homemade sandwich loaf bread Ingredients:
    4 cups all purpose flour
    2 1/2 tablespoons baking powder
    1 1/2 tablespoons sugar
    1 teaspoon salt
    1/4 cup vegetable oil
    2 1/4 cups milk
    ENJOY!

      Chrissy’s Sausage, Peppers & White Beans
      3 lbs ITALIAN SAUSAGE LINKS, *HOT OR MILD
      1 32oz can CRUSHED TOMATOES, undrained
      1 32oz can DICED TOMATOES, undrained
      2 15oz can WHITE BEANS, drained
      2 LG YELLOW ONIONS, SLICED CORE TO STEM
      2 LG GREEN BELL PEPPERS, SLICED INTO STRIPS
      4 STALKS CELERY, THINLY SLICED
      15-20 LARGE CLOVES GARLIC, THICKLY SLICED
      ½ TSP RED PEPPER FLAKES (TO TASTE)
      1 ½ TSP KOSHER SALT
      1 HEAPING TABLESPOON SMOKED PAPRIKA
      1 HEAPING TEASPOON ITALIAN HERB BLEND
      ½-3/4 CUP WINE
      =Add 1 tablespoons of olive oil to heavy bottomed Dutch Oven.
      =Brown Sausage over Medium-High. Remove to plate once browned but still pink in center.
      =Add additional 1 tablespoon olive oil & sauté onions, celery, peppers & garlic until crisp-tender.
      =Add Tomatoes, Beans, Wine & all Seasonings.
      =Cover & Bring to a gentle simmer.
      =Return Sausages (& any juices on plate) to pot and submerge below surface of tomato mixture.
      =Simmer on Very Low heat for aprox 45-60 minutes, stirring occasionally .
      =Serve in bowls, over Buttered Rice.
